cli-tool — command-line tools

This sub-skill stands up a command-line tool with a clean, predictable UX (subcommands, --help, sane exit codes), a genuine test suite, and a publish path to PyPI or npm. It follows the pattern of small, well-named launcher CLIs that install via pip/npm and just work on PATH. When the tool is meant for the public, it composes with the oss-library sub-skill.


What this sub-skill is for

A program invoked from the shell: a one-shot command, a multi-subcommand tool, or a daemon/CLI hybrid. Use it for dev tools and terminal utilities; not for GUI apps (desktop-app), web UIs (website), or backends (api-backend). Pairs with oss-library for public packages and with cli-anything when the goal is to wrap an existing GUI app into an agent-drivable CLI.

Mandatory grill-questions (fold into the DoR)

  1. Language/ecosystem — Python (Click/Typer, pip) or Node (Commander/oclif/yargs, npm). Recommended: Python + Typer for a fast, ergonomic CLI, unless the target users live in npm. Lock this first.
  2. Command name & shape — the binary name (short, memorable) and whether it's single-command or has subcommands (tool sub --flag). Confirm the name is free on PyPI/npm.
  3. CLI UX contract — global flags (--help, --version, --quiet, --json), exit-code convention (0 ok, non-zero per failure class), and whether output is human-readable, JSON, or both.
  4. Distribution — published to PyPI/npm, or a standalone single-file binary (PyInstaller / pkg / Bun)? If public, this composes oss-library. Decide the version scheme (SemVer).
  5. Config & state — does it read config/env/stdin? Where does config live (XDG / ~/.config)? Does it need network/API keys (then env-var or keyring, never hard-coded)?
  6. Test strategy — pytest (Python) or jest/vitest (Node); how subcommands and exit codes get asserted; whether a CI matrix across OSes/versions is needed.
  7. Distribution & support OSes — Linux/macOS/Windows; shell-completion scripts wanted?

Stack defaults & done-bar

Default stack: Python 3.12 + Typer, pyproject.toml console-script, pytest, GitHub Actions (test + publish on tag), PyPI distribution — i.e. the small, well-named launcher-CLI pattern. (Switch to Node/Commander if the audience is npm.) Done-bar (all true): tool --help and tool --version work; every subcommand has help and the right exit code (0 success, non-zero on failure); the test suite passes in CI; a fresh pip install/npm install puts the command on PATH and it runs; --json output (if promised) is valid; README/usage and changelog match the real commands; a tagged GitHub Release (and PyPI/npm publish, if public) has gone out end-to-end.

Guardrails

  • No emojis in CLI output — typographic symbols only; keep stdout machine-parseable and stderr for diagnostics.
  • Exit codes are a contract: never exit 0 on failure; document each non-zero code.
  • Never hard-code or commit API keys/tokens — read from env/keyring; .gitignore secrets; ask the user to supply publish tokens.
  • Don't claim it's published until release-engineer confirms the package is live and pip/npm install actually resolves it.

  • Respect SemVer — breaking flag/subcommand changes are a major bump; note them in the changelog.
